“智能感知与自主系统”课程思政教学改革探索与实践

摘  要:为培养新一代信息技术与人工智能等新兴战略产业和智能装备等国防科技前沿领域急需的高层次复合型创新人才,依托“智能感知与自主系统”硕士研究生专业选修课程,开展课程思政教学设计与实践探索。通过设计思政案例、创新教学方法、教学实践与效果反馈相结合,将思政元素有机融入课程教学,取得了良好的教学效果。研究成果对激发学生投身智能系统研发、服务国家战略需求、实现自我价值追求的爱国主义精神具有积极作用,可为其他工学类专业课程开展课程思政教学改革提供参考。To cultivate a new generation of high-level innovative talents needed in emerging strategic industries such as information technology and artificial intelligence and frontier fields of national defense science and technology such as intelligent equipment,the curriculum ideological and political teaching design and practical exploration are carried out based on the professional elective course of“Intelligent Perception and Autonomous System”for master students.Through the design of ideological and political cases,innovative teaching methods,teaching practice and effect feedback,the elements of ideological and political education are organically integrated into the course teaching,and good teaching results are achieved.The research results play a positive role in inspiring students to devote themselves to the research and development of intelligent systems,serve the national strategic needs,and realize the patriotism of self-value pursuit,and can provide references for other engineering professional courses to carry out curriculum ideology and politics teaching reform.
